// Copyright 2020 The Go Authors. All rights reserved.
// Use of this source code is governed by a BSD-style
// license that can be found in the LICENSE file.

package completion

import (
	"fmt"
	"strings"
	"testing"

	"github.com/google/go-cmp/cmp"
	"golang.org/x/tools/gopls/internal/hooks"
	. "golang.org/x/tools/gopls/internal/lsp/regtest"
	"golang.org/x/tools/internal/bug"
	"golang.org/x/tools/internal/testenv"

	"golang.org/x/tools/gopls/internal/lsp/protocol"
)

func TestMain(m *testing.M) {
	bug.PanicOnBugs = true
	Main(m, hooks.Options)
}

const proxy = `
-- example.com@v1.2.3/go.mod --
module example.com

go 1.12
-- example.com@v1.2.3/blah/blah.go --
package blah

const Name = "Blah"
-- random.org@v1.2.3/go.mod --
module random.org

go 1.12
-- random.org@v1.2.3/blah/blah.go --
package hello

const Name = "Hello"
`

func TestPackageCompletion(t *testing.T) {
	const files = `
-- go.mod --
module mod.com

go 1.12
-- fruits/apple.go --
package apple

fun apple() int {
	return 0
}

-- fruits/testfile.go --
// this is a comment

/*
 this is a multiline comment
*/

import "fmt"

func test() {}

-- fruits/testfile2.go --
package

-- fruits/testfile3.go --
pac
-- 123f_r.u~its-123/testfile.go --
package

-- .invalid-dir@-name/testfile.go --
package
`
	var (
		testfile4 = ""
		testfile5 = "/*a comment*/ "
		testfile6 = "/*a comment*/\n"
	)
	for _, tc := range []struct {
		name          string
		filename      string
		content       *string
		triggerRegexp string
		want          []string
		editRegexp    string
	}{
		{
			name:          "package completion at valid position",
			filename:      "fruits/testfile.go",
			triggerRegexp: "\n()",
			want:          []string{"package apple", "package apple_test", "package fruits", "package fruits_test", "package main"},
			editRegexp:    "\n()",
		},
		{
			name:          "package completion in a comment",
			filename:      "fruits/testfile.go",
			triggerRegexp: "th(i)s",
			want:          nil,
		},
		{
			name:          "package completion in a multiline comment",
			filename:      "fruits/testfile.go",
			triggerRegexp: `\/\*\n()`,
			want:          nil,
		},
		{
			name:          "package completion at invalid position",
			filename:      "fruits/testfile.go",
			triggerRegexp: "import \"fmt\"\n()",
			want:          nil,
		},
		{
			name:          "package completion after keyword 'package'",
			filename:      "fruits/testfile2.go",
			triggerRegexp: "package()",
			want:          []string{"package apple", "package apple_test", "package fruits", "package fruits_test", "package main"},
			editRegexp:    "package\n",
		},
		{
			name:          "package completion with 'pac' prefix",
			filename:      "fruits/testfile3.go",
			triggerRegexp: "pac()",
			want:          []string{"package apple", "package apple_test", "package fruits", "package fruits_test", "package main"},
			editRegexp:    "pac",
		},
		{
			name:          "package completion for empty file",
			filename:      "fruits/testfile4.go",
			triggerRegexp: "^$",
			content:       &testfile4,
			want:          []string{"package apple", "package apple_test", "package fruits", "package fruits_test", "package main"},
			editRegexp:    "^$",
		},
		{
			name:          "package completion without terminal newline",
			filename:      "fruits/testfile5.go",
			triggerRegexp: `\*\/ ()`,
			content:       &testfile5,
			want:          []string{"package apple", "package apple_test", "package fruits", "package fruits_test", "package main"},
			editRegexp:    `\*\/ ()`,
		},
		{
			name:          "package completion on terminal newline",
			filename:      "fruits/testfile6.go",
			triggerRegexp: `\*\/\n()`,
			content:       &testfile6,
			want:          []string{"package apple", "package apple_test", "package fruits", "package fruits_test", "package main"},
			editRegexp:    `\*\/\n()`,
		},
		// Issue golang/go#44680
		{
			name:          "package completion for dir name with punctuation",
			filename:      "123f_r.u~its-123/testfile.go",
			triggerRegexp: "package()",
			want:          []string{"package fruits123", "package fruits123_test", "package main"},
			editRegexp:    "package\n",
		},
		{
			name:          "package completion for invalid dir name",
			filename:      ".invalid-dir@-name/testfile.go",
			triggerRegexp: "package()",
			want:          []string{"package main"},
			editRegexp:    "package\n",
		},
	} {
		t.Run(tc.name, func(t *testing.T) {
			Run(t, files, func(t *testing.T, env *Env) {
				if tc.content != nil {
					env.WriteWorkspaceFile(tc.filename, *tc.content)
					env.Await(env.DoneWithChangeWatchedFiles())
				}
				env.OpenFile(tc.filename)
				completions := env.Completion(env.RegexpSearch(tc.filename, tc.triggerRegexp))

				// Check that the completion item suggestions are in the range
				// of the file. {Start,End}.Line are zero-based.
				lineCount := len(strings.Split(env.BufferText(tc.filename), "\n"))
				for _, item := range completions.Items {
					if start := int(item.TextEdit.Range.Start.Line); start > lineCount {
						t.Fatalf("unexpected text edit range start line number: got %d, want <= %d", start, lineCount)
					}
					if end := int(item.TextEdit.Range.End.Line); end > lineCount {
						t.Fatalf("unexpected text edit range end line number: got %d, want <= %d", end, lineCount)
					}
				}

				if tc.want != nil {
					expectedLoc := env.RegexpSearch(tc.filename, tc.editRegexp)
					for _, item := range completions.Items {
						gotRng := item.TextEdit.Range
						if expectedLoc.Range != gotRng {
							t.Errorf("unexpected completion range for completion item %s: got %v, want %v",
								item.Label, gotRng, expectedLoc.Range)
						}
					}
				}

				diff := compareCompletionLabels(tc.want, completions.Items)
				if diff != "" {
					t.Error(diff)
				}
			})
		})
	}
}

func TestPackageNameCompletion(t *testing.T) {
	const files = `
-- go.mod --
module mod.com

go 1.12
-- math/add.go --
package ma
`

	want := []string{"ma", "ma_test", "main", "math", "math_test"}
	Run(t, files, func(t *testing.T, env *Env) {
		env.OpenFile("math/add.go")
		completions := env.Completion(env.RegexpSearch("math/add.go", "package ma()"))

		diff := compareCompletionLabels(want, completions.Items)
		if diff != "" {
			t.Fatal(diff)
		}
	})
}

// TODO(rfindley): audit/clean up call sites for this helper, to ensure
// consistent test errors.
func compareCompletionLabels(want []string, gotItems []protocol.CompletionItem) string {
	var got []string
	for _, item := range gotItems {
		got = append(got, item.Label)
		if item.Label != item.InsertText && item.TextEdit == nil {
			// Label should be the same as InsertText, if InsertText is to be used
			return fmt.Sprintf("label not the same as InsertText %#v", item)
		}
	}

	if len(got) == 0 && len(want) == 0 {
		return "" // treat nil and the empty slice as equivalent
	}

	if diff := cmp.Diff(want, got); diff != "" {
		return fmt.Sprintf("completion item mismatch (-want +got):\n%s", diff)
	}
	return ""
}

func TestPackageMemberCompletionAfterSyntaxError(t *testing.T) {
	// This test documents the current broken behavior due to golang/go#58833.
	const src = `
-- go.mod --
module mod.com

go 1.14

-- main.go --
package main

import "math"

func main() {
	math.Sqrt(,0)
	math.Ldex
}
`
	Run(t, src, func(t *testing.T, env *Env) {
		env.OpenFile("main.go")
		env.Await(env.DoneWithOpen())
		loc := env.RegexpSearch("main.go", "Ldex()")
		completions := env.Completion(loc)
		if len(completions.Items) == 0 {
			t.Fatalf("no completion items")
		}
		env.AcceptCompletion(loc, completions.Items[0])
		env.Await(env.DoneWithChange())
		got := env.BufferText("main.go")
		// The completion of math.Ldex after the syntax error on the
		// previous line is not "math.Ldexp" but "math.Ldexmath.Abs".
		// (In VSCode, "Abs" wrongly appears in the completion menu.)
		// This is a consequence of poor error recovery in the parser
		// causing "math.Ldex" to become a BadExpr.
		want := "package main\n\nimport \"math\"\n\nfunc main() {\n\tmath.Sqrt(,0)\n\tmath.Ldexmath.Abs(${1:})\n}\n"
		if diff := cmp.Diff(want, got); diff != "" {
			t.Errorf("unimported completion (-want +got):\n%s", diff)
		}
	})
}
